Wilt thou go with this man?

Wilt  thou go with this  man?

Question of a lifetime.

Will you go with this man?

Genesis  24:58 And they called Rebekah, and said unto her, Wilt thou go with this man? And she said, I will go.

The man of sorrow.

Isaiah  53:3 He is despised and rejected of men; a man of sorrows, and acquainted with grief: and we hid as it were our faces from him; he was despised, and we esteemed him not.  53:4 Surely he hath borne our griefs, and carried our sorrows: yet we did esteem him stricken, smitten of God, and afflicted.  53:5 But he was wounded for our transgressions, he was bruised for our iniquities: the chastisement of our peace was upon him; and with his stripes we are healed.

The man of Galilie.

Matthew  4:23 And Jesus went about all Galilee, teaching in their synagogues, and preaching the gospel of the kingdom, and healing all manner of sickness and all manner of disease among the people.

When you go with Him, He will save you from all sins, without biblical salvation, within biblical sanctification.

Matthew  1:21 And she shall bring forth a son, and thou shalt call his name JESUS: for he shall save his people from their sins.

He will lead you to your greener pasture, earlier fulfilment.

John  10:9 I am the door: by me if any man enter in, he shall be saved, and shall go in and out, and find pasture.

He will give you life eternal. Eternity with God.

John  10:27 My sheep hear my voice, and I know them, and they follow me:  10:28 And I give unto them eternal life; and they shall never perish, neither shall any man pluck them out of my hand.

Matthew  25:46 And these shall go away into everlasting punishment: but the righteous into life eternal.

Come follow Jesus everywhere, and Everytime and be fulfilled here and hereafter.

Revelation  14:4 These are they which were not defiled with women; for they are virgins. These are they which follow the Lamb whithersoever he goeth. These were redeemed from among men, being the firstfruits unto God and to the Lamb.  14:5 And in their mouth was found no guile: for they are without fault before the throne of God.
